本文共 805 字,大约阅读时间需要 2 分钟。
在项目开发过程中,phoneBook.vue组件作为数据管理中心,承担着整合和处理各模块数据的重要任务。其中,“phonBooks”这一数据项的定义与赋值是整个应用运行的基础突破口。本文将详细介绍phoneBook.vue中的数据处理逻辑及数据传递机制,重点分析“phonBooks”数据的作用和应用场景。
phoneBook.vue组件中“phonBooks”这一数据项,采用嵌套结构设计,涵盖了电话簿核心信息维度。通过在组件实例中对“phonBooks”进行初始化,确保数据源可靠性和完整性。这种设计理念与现代应用场景相匹配,特别是在处理有大量动态数据交互的场景中现已得到广泛认可。
跨组件间的数据传递是Vue.js应用中常见问题。针对此处的组件间通信需求,采用标签传递数据的方式,这种方式的优势在于实现了事件驱动的高效率传递。具体而言,通过自定义事件标签,phoneBook.vue组件将查询结果传递给list组件,保证数据的及时性和一致性。同时,这一机制也为其他组件如Search提供了基础数据支持。
在这个复杂的多组件应用架构中,数据的互动逻辑设计至关重要。phoneBook.vue不仅储存了原始数据,同时对数据进行轻量级预处理,使得无论是list组件还是Search组件处理数据时,都能够满足不同的业务需求。通过这种方式,API调用单独的数据获取模块,确保数据来源的安全性和复用性,同时提高了应用整体性能表现。
该组件被广泛应用于多个功能模块中,包括电话簿的逐步查询、批量数据的筛选处理以及数据的实时展示等。因此,phoneBook.vue所设计的数据处理机制,不仅满足了当前的功能需求,还为未来的功能扩展奠定了坚实基础。在实际应用中,这一组件表现出了良好的扩展性和稳定性,为整个系统的性能提升提供了重要支撑。
转载地址:http://dhusz.baihongyu.com/